Isolation and characterization of hydrocarbonoclastic bacteria from Algerian coast

2017

Backgrounds The contamination of marine environments by hydrocarbons represents a global concern with consequences on ecosystems and human health. The removal of HC by physical and/or chemical methods is expensive and disrespectful of the environment. The use of HC degrading bacteria is a good alternative for environmental remediation (bioremediation). Objectives The Algerian coastline is exposed to several types of pollutions, including hydrocarbons. The aim was to explore the bioremediation potential of its contaminated harbors for the first time. Evaluation in microcosm of biostimulation and bioaugmentation efficacy on diesel-contaminated soil

2021

Bioremediation is a promising technology for the treatment of hydrocarbon (HC) contaminated soils that is based on the biodegradation capacities of native or introduced microbial populations. Biotractability tests are essential for choosing the optimal bioremediation treatment. For this purpose, multiple microcosm tests, based on biostimulation by landfarming or bioventing and addition of nutrients, were conducted for 120 days on a soil contaminated by diesel, after assessing its intrinsic catabolic potential. Defective insulin secretory response to intravenous glucose in C57Bl/6J compared to C57Bl/6N mice

2014

Objective: The C57Bl/6J (Bl/6J) mouse is the most widely used strain in metabolic research. This strain carries a mutation in nicotinamide nucleotide transhydrogenase (Nnt), a mitochondrial enzyme involved in NADPH production, which has been suggested to lead to glucose intolerance and beta-cell dysfunction. However, recent reports comparing Bl/6J to Bl/6N (carrying the wild-type Nnt allele) under normal diet have led to conflicting results using glucose tolerance tests. Thus, we assessed glucose-stimulated insulin secretion (GSIS), insulin sensitivity, clearance and central glucose-induced insulin secretion in Bl/6J and N mice using gold-standard methodologies. Life Imprisonment Without Prospect of Release: Comparative Remarks from a Human-Rights Perspective

2019

Life imprisonment without prospect of release is a penalty experiencing remarkable success today, especially in Europe. However, certain human rights bodies have recently begun to assert that this penalty runs counter the so-called ‘right to hope’, derived by way of interpretation from the right not to be subject to inhuman or degrading treatment. The purpose of the present contribution is to shed light on the potential and the limits of such trend by analyzing the case-law of universal (such as the UN system) and regional (the European system, the Inter-American system; the African system) bodies.

Isolation and Characterization of Oil-Degrading Bacteria from Bilge Water

2015

Twenty-one oil-degrading bacteria were isolated from bilge water. Based on a high growth rate on crude oil and on hydrocarbon degradation ability, 7 strains were selected (from 21 isolated) for further studies. 16S rRNA gene sequencing showed that isolated strains were affiliated to Bacillus, Pseudomonas and Halomonas genera; in particular, isolate BW-B12 (Bacillus sp., 99%), BW-C12 (Halomonas boliviensis, 99%) and BW-E12 (Halomonas boliviensis, 98%) were the best crude-oil degraders; after 10 days of cultivation in ONR 7a mineral medium supplemented with crude oil as single carbon source BW-B12, BW-C12 and BW-E12 showed a degradation rate of 80, 60 and 59%, respectively. Blue biotechnology: enhancement of bioremediation using bacterial biofilms on biodegradable scaffolds

2016

Petroleum hydrocarbons are still the most threatening environmental pollutants. A promising non invasive and low-cost technology for the treatment of contaminated sites is based on bioremediation by biodegrading microorganism endowed with catabolic ability towards oil and derivatives. New methods are needed to enhance and optimize natural biodegradation, such as the immobilization of hydrocarbons degraders in many types of supports. We developed a scaffold-bacteria bioremediation system to clean up oil contamination based on degradable 3D scaffolds. A New Technique for Implementing ECtHR Judgments: Will It Work? The Corte Costituzionale “Urges” the Houses to Reform the Ergastolo Ostativo

2021

In this much-awaited ruling (Order No. 97 of 15 April 2021), the Corte Costituzionale had to decide on the constitutionality of the existing prohibition on release on parole for life prisoners convicted for Mafia-related crimes, in the absence of any cooperation with justice (ergastolo ostativo). This form of life imprisonment without prospect of release had already been deemed in contrast with Article 3 of the European Convention of Human Rights (echr) in the judgment rendered by the Strasbourg Court in Viola v. Blue biotechnology: oil bioremediation using hydrocarbon-degrading bacteria immobilized on biodegradable membranes

2017

A novel bioremediation system to clean up oil contaminated water was developed combining hydrocarbon (HC) degrading bacteria immobilized and polylactic acid (PLA) or polycaprolactone (PCL) membranes prepared by electrospinning. The bioremediation efficiency was tested on crude oil using highly performant HC degrading bacterial strains isolated from marine and soil environments. The membrane morphology, the microbial adhesion and proliferation were evaluated using scanning electron microscopy (SEM).
